Holy Ground - Wedding Joy

Country Pavilion, L. Daniel, 9 x 12, NFS


I painted this wonderful old, rock pavilion last fall after my daughter chose it as her marriage site. Last Saturday was her wedding day and she married the love of her life. I felt as if I was on holy ground as they exchanged vows and committed the rest of their lives to one another. It was truly a magical time.


Many of you have sent me kind notes of congratulations - thank you so, so much. Here are a few pictures of the beautiful day...

Country Pavilion

Country Pavilion, L. Daniel, 9 x 12

This wonderful pavilion is in the countryside south of Austin and was the location of our paintout this week. It is beautiful with rolling grass lands, a creek, and huge trees; the structure has a wonderful, well-loved patina.

AND, this is where my daughter will be getting married next June, so it's especially significant to me!! She will actually walk under this arbor and through the pavilion on her way to the ceremony which will be held at the creek side. It's going to be a beautiful, happy time.
